Кто такой верстальщик и чем он занимается

Что такое верстка

Веб-верстка представляет собой процесс создания веб-страниц с использованием языков разметки, таких как HTML (HyperText Markup Language) и стилевых таблиц CSS (Cascading Style Sheets). HTML определяет структуру и содержимое страницы, в то время как CSS задает ее внешний вид и оформление. Вместе эти технологии позволяют верстальщикам создавать функциональные и привлекательные интерфейсы для пользователей веб-сайтов.

Верстальщик — кто он?

Верстальщик (иногда называемый фронтенд-разработчиком) — это специалист, который отвечает за перевод дизайнерских макетов в код.

Он использует HTML и CSS для создания визуальной составляющей веб-страницы, согласно предоставленным дизайнером спецификациям. В работе верстальщика важно учитывать не только внешний вид страницы, но и ее доступность и совместимость с различными браузерами и устройствами.

Чем занимается верстальщик

Кто такой верстальщик и чем он занимается

Основные задачи верстальщика включают:

  • Верстка макетов: Преобразование графических макетов в интерактивные веб-страницы с использованием HTML и CSS.
  • Адаптивная и кроссбраузерная верстка: Обеспечение корректного отображения веб-страниц на различных устройствах (мобильные телефоны, планшеты, десктопы) и в различных браузерах.
  • Оптимизация производительности: Улучшение загрузки страницы, оптимизация кода для ускорения работы сайта.
  • Совместная работа с дизайнерами и разработчиками: Взаимодействие с командой для достижения целей проекта и улучшения пользовательского опыта.

Инструменты верстальщика

Кто такой верстальщик и чем он занимается

Для вёрстки на HTML и CSS специалисты активно применяют различные инструменты и технологии для оптимизации своей работы. Одним из основных инструментов являются CSS-фреймворки, такие как Bootstrap. Bootstrap предоставляет готовые компоненты и стили, что значительно ускоряет процесс верстки. Например, с помощью Bootstrap можно легко создать адаптивные сетки, модальные окна, кнопки и другие элементы интерфейса, что освобождает верстальщика от необходимости писать множество кастомных стилей с нуля.

Читайте так же  Стритбол на даче - полезно и интересно

CSS-препроцессоры, такие как SASS (Syntactically Awesome Style Sheets), предоставляют дополнительные возможности для организации и написания CSS. Они поддерживают переменные, миксины, вложенные правила и другие функции, что делает код CSS более читаемым и управляемым. Например, использование переменных позволяет легко изменять цвета и шрифты на всем сайте, применяя изменения в одном месте.

Другие популярные инструменты в арсенале верстальщиков включают пакетные менеджеры, такие как npm или yarn, которые позволяют управлять зависимостями проекта и устанавливать необходимые библиотеки и фреймворки одной командой. Это упрощает начальную настройку проекта и поддержание его в актуальном состоянии.

Верстальщики также могут использовать инструменты для проверки совместимости браузеров, такие как BrowserStack или CrossBrowserTesting, чтобы убедиться, что их верстка выглядит одинаково хорошо на всех популярных браузерах и устройствах.

Использование этого не только упрощает работу верстальщиков, но и повышает качество и консистентность веб-страниц, что важно для обеспечения приятного пользовательского опыта и эффективной работы веб-проекта. В итоге, верстальщик играет ключевую роль в процессе создания современных веб-интерфейсов, обеспечивая их функциональность, красоту и удобство использования для пользователей.